Ingredients to Look For

I pay close attention to the ingredient list. Ideally, the pot pie should contain real chicken, fresh vegetables, and a flaky crust made from simple ingredients like flour and butter. I avoid pies that list unrecognizable chemicals or fillers. The presence of recognizable, natural ingredients is key to me.

Size and Portion Considerations

I consider the size of the pot pie depending on my appetite or the number of people I am serving. Single-serving pies are convenient for quick meals, while larger pies work better for family dinners. Knowing the portion size helps me plan my meal without waste.

Cooking and Preparation Convenience

Since I often rely on frozen meals for convenience, I look for pot pies that have straightforward cooking instructions. I prefer options that can go directly from freezer to oven without complicated prep. Quick cooking times are a plus when I’m short on time.

Packaging and Storage

I check how the product is packaged to ensure it stays fresh in the freezer. Durable packaging that prevents freezer burn is important. I also appreciate clear labeling on the package about storage guidelines and expiration dates.

Price and Value

I balance quality with cost by comparing prices of different all natural frozen chicken pot pies. Sometimes paying a bit more for higher quality ingredients and better taste is worth it. I look for good value in terms of portion size, ingredient quality, and overall flavor.

Dietary Needs and Preferences

I consider any dietary restrictions or preferences when selecting a pot pie. Some all natural options may be gluten-free or lower in sodium, which can be important for health reasons. I always review the nutrition facts to make sure the product fits my dietary goals.
